What are Steroids? Their Use and Effects in Bodybuilding

Steroids, or anabolic steroids, are synthetic variations of the male sex hormone testosterone. They are used in medicine to treat specific conditions, but their popularity has surged among bodybuilders and athletes aiming to enhance performance and physique. These substances can promote muscle growth, increase strength, and improve endurance, leading many to consider their use in bodybuilding practices.

Types of Steroids in Bodybuilding

There are several types of steroids that bodybuilders commonly use, including:

  1. Testosterone: The primary male hormone, testosterone, is the base for the majority of anabolic steroids.
  2. Dianabol: Known for its ability to significantly increase muscle mass and strength.
  3. Deca-Durabolin: Favored for its less aggressive side effects and ability to help joint pain.
  4. Winstrol: Often used for cutting cycles due to its ability to maintain muscle while losing fat.

The Effects of Steroids in Bodybuilding

While steroids can yield impressive physical results, they also come with a range of potential side effects, both mental and physical. Some short-term effects may include:

  1. Increased muscle mass and strength
  2. Improved recovery times
  3. Enhanced performance during workouts

However, long-term use and abuse can lead to serious health risks such as:

  1. Cardiovascular issues
  2. Hormonal imbalances
  3. Liver damage
  4. Psychological effects like aggression and mood swings

Conclusion

In summary, while steroids can be effective for enhancing bodybuilding performance and results, the risks involved must be carefully considered. The decision to use steroids should not be taken lightly, and individuals should prioritize their health above all. Consulting with a healthcare professional before starting any steroid regimen is paramount for safety and well-being.
